Boost is boost. You can drive the whipple around town without boosting. Im always in vacuum when driving around town. I can drive my car around town shifting at 4 rpm without boosting at all. You only boost when you literally floor the pedal so that deal about the centris better for the engine when driving around town is rediculous.
